Home > Perl Error > Perl Error Use Of Uninitialized Value In Split

Perl Error Use Of Uninitialized Value In Split

How can I disable this message from coming up on new shells without hacking all of that out of PERLBREW? Reason: Changed much of the code. Join them; it only takes a minute: Sign up Where is the error “Use of uninitialized value in string ne” coming from? He runs the Perl Weekly newsletter. http://exactcomputerrepair.com/perl-error/perl-error-9.html

For more advanced trainees it can be a desktop reference, and a collection of the base knowledge needed to proceed with system and network administration. Please visit this page to clear all LQ-related cookies. Some of the other lines of the WHILE loop work fine. Terms Privacy Security Status Help You can't perform that action at this time. http://www.perlmonks.org/index.pl?node_id=303245

Lance Hoffmeyer Guest I keep getting Use of uninitialized value in split at ./birthday.pl line 33. Gabor also runs the Perl Maven site. This is to accommodate operations such as: if ($foo == "1002") # string "1002" is converted to a number if ($foo eq 1002) # number 1002 is converted to a string

You should look for the places where the variable got the last assignment, or you should try to understand why that piece of code has never been executed. Having a problem logging in? Hello All.. Here is the faulty code: #!/usr/bin/perl -w use strict; use Text::Wrap; use PDF::Create; use CGI qw(:standard); use DBI(); CGI::ReadParse(); #define how many columns text to be wrapped to $Text::Wrap::columns = 58;

Reprojecting coordinates without building geometry object in ArcPy? vjx242 View Public Profile View LQ Blog View Review Entries View HCL Entries Find More Posts by vjx242 04-22-2011, 01:06 PM #5 grail LQ Guru Registered: Sep 2009 Location: What Am I? http://stackoverflow.com/questions/7864458/perl-uninitialized-value-in-error Main Menu LQ Calendar LQ Rules LQ Sitemap Site FAQ View New Posts View Latest Posts Zero Reply Threads LQ Wiki Most Wanted Jeremy's Blog Report LQ Bug Syndicate Latest

In it, you'll get: The week's top questions and answers Important community announcements Questions that need answers see an example newsletter By subscribing, you agree to the privacy policy and terms Solve it by initializing the values on those lines. Blooming my Zygocactus houseplant How bad is it to have multiple devices with the same SSH server keys? Is cheese seasoned by default?

regex perl share|improve this question edited Sep 23 '13 at 9:12 asked Sep 23 '13 at 9:07 user2728203 @RohitJain I have given the code now –user2728203 Sep 23 '13 http://perlmaven.com/use-of-uninitialized-value I tried setting the used values to '0' before the code execution (but that did not work). more hot questions question feed lang-perl about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ation by Jim Gibson Re: supressing error message Use of uninitialized value in concatenation....

I have managed to make this mistake several times. this contact form How could I have modern computers without GUIs? If a blockchain is a distributed database, where is the data? Any suggestions on how to disable this message?

Use of uninitialized value $record_score in numeric gt (>) at ./hash_bowl line 10, line 7. User Name Remember Me? I set the scope right for all the variables - and the codes runs. have a peek here Reload to refresh your session.

share|improve this answer answered Oct 23 '11 at 5:09 bobbymcr 18.2k13458 I tried setting $this_date to zero, but I still gets the same errors. asked 4 years ago viewed 23524 times active 4 years ago Get the weekly newsletter! Which is recommended.

Some of the other >lines of the WHILE loop work fine. > > >When running the script below.

On a quick look, although hard to read (see rod's post above), the following looks out of place: Code: sub comparison { my $j = 0; #keep an index of the Since the two pieces of code connect to the same database and the select statements are identical, you probably want to look at param('iid'). You are currently viewing LQ as a guest. I would guess this is the likely culprit.

Privacy Policy Terms and Rules Help Connect With Us Log-in Register Contact Us Forum software by XenForo™ ©2010-2015 XenForo Ltd. In a loop or not has nothing to do with this problem. Sending HTML e-mail using Email::Stuffer Perl/CGI script with Apache2 JSON in Perl Simple Database access using Perl DBI and SQL Reading from LDAP in Perl using Net::LDAP Common warnings and error Check This Out Prev Next Written by Gabor Szabo Comments In the comments, please wrap your code snippets within

tags and use spaces for indentation.

For example: $ perlbrew help Use of uninitialized value in scalar assignment at /loader/0x1ba89870/App/perlbrew.pm line 1. ##... What’s the reading order for Superior Iron Man? I'm currently teaching myself perl. The question does not have to be directly related to Linux and any language is fair game.

jspc referenced this issue Sep 19, 2012 Merged Fix for manpath error on installation #236 jspc commented Sep 19, 2012 There is an open pull request to fix this at #236 more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ed It is often better to put in a 'die' statement just beyond where you think everything is okay, so you don't get too swamped with error messages. Tips for dexterously handling bike lights with winter gloves How are beats formed when frequencies combine?

What mechanical effects would the common cold have?